AR-CM1 - Construction Mgr I

Construction Manager Accountable for all Civil Works and associated financial control via Scheduling (time), SP/ASP and Quality Management on a given project.

Ensure that all Service Providers are adhering to Ericsson standards, processes and procedures as well as all Federal and Local standards.

Identifies continuous improvement opportunities.

Interfaces with External Interfaces: ASP/SP, Customer PM Internal Interfaces: IM Lead, Project Admin, Project Sponsor, CPM

Responsibilities Include

" Assess and control charges to the agreed site design

" Assures that: o Only Customer s approved materials are installed on the project o The agreed Civil Works guidelines and schedules are followed and enforced.

" Attend coordination and progress meetings

" Awareness and on-site supervision during where risk of disturbances in customer site performance is high.

" Check that the working environment is maintained at an acceptable level, carry out safety inspections and ensure that tools, etc. are in good working condition.

" Civil Works problem solving as required during the project.

" Coordinates site activities and assures that all disciplines directly involved in the project are in phase with the Project goals and objectives.

" Drive schedule activities and trouble-shooting results.

" Ensure that: o Service Providers and vendors/suppliers meet all the technical specifications with respect to E and customer specifications. o Workmanship quality of the installations done by the Service

Providers is within the Contract, Ericsson standards and Customer expectations. o All Ericsson, Federal, Local, and customer safety guidelines and construction procedures are enforced during the entire Civil Works phase of the project.

" Knowledge in workers safety and work environment safety.

" Perform: o Site pre-inspections and coordinate post-construction audits. o Site verification. o Visual inspection of quality on site.

" Prepares regular interval progress reports as required by the project

" Provide accurate status information on the progress to project management.

" Provide technical assistance to the Service Providers and any other suppliers that provide services associated with the Civil Works activities.

" Reject wrong deliveries of material to site.

" Report bad performance and quality on site.

" Responsible for the proper interpretation and compliance of the civil design plans.

" Supervise, coordinate and monitor works with the Service Providers and other disciplines that have an interface with the Civil Works part of the project.

" Team leadership focusing on quality and results.

" Write claims, order and return materials.
